President Goodluck Jonathan on Saturday vowed that activities of terrorists that have been unleashing violence on parts of the country would not deter him from the goal of transforming Nigeria into a prosperous nation.

He therefore called on all Nigerians to remain strong and resolute in defence of freedom, unity, law and order, peace, security and progress of the nation.

Jonathan made the pledge in his Eid-el-Fitri message made available to journalists in Abuja.

He said it was his wish that as Muslims celebrate Eid-el-Fitri, the lessons of Ramadan and the Holy Prophet’s  teachings of piety, love, justice, fairness, equity, peaceful co-existence with others, tolerance, honesty and dedication to duty would remain with Nigerians for the benefit and greater glory of the country.

He said he felt the pains and anguish of Nigerians who have experienced the harrowing effect of terrorism but they must never surrender as the terrorists wanted.

The statement read, “Although the observance of the Holy Month was sadly tainted in parts of the country with the continuing atrocities of extremists and terrorists in our midst, I urge all patriotic Nigerians to remain strong and resolute in defence of freedom, unity, law and order, peace, security and progress of the nation.

“I feel the pains and anguish of all our compatriots who have experienced the harrowing impact of terrorism unleashed on them by brainwashed and misguided agents of evil and disunity, but we must never throw up our hands in helplessness and despair as the terrorists and purveyors of anarchy want.

“Going forward, let us all remain unwaveringly committed to showing solidarity with our Armed Forces and security agencies and giving them the full support they require to prosecute the war against terrorism to a successful conclusion.

“I assure all Nigerians, once again, that we are totally committed to winning that war, putting the scourge of terrorism and insecurity rapidly behind us and giving the fullest possible attention to the urgent task of improving the living conditions of our people in all parts of the country.

“We cannot and will not be deterred from our goal of positively transforming our nation into a strong, united, progressive, stable, secure and prosperous nation in which all citizens will live in peace in spite of our immense diversities.

“May Almighty Allah continue to bless our nation and all who have successfully undertaken this year’s Ramadan Fast.”
